## Runbook: Slow autocomplete index (Quickquill)

Symptoms: suggestion latency over 800ms, timeouts in the Marrowfield dashboard. Usual cause: the Quickquill index fell behind on compaction. Check segment count first; anything over 40 means compaction stalled. Kick it manually with `quickquill compact --force`. Do not restart the indexer during compaction — it corrupts the tail segment. The compaction endpoint requires auth against the internal Quickquill admin API; use the key below.

gateway credential: kto23_LX9A4ys6i4nzHtpOLNLodKK

- [ ] Turnstile upgrade: The old swipe turnstiles in the Larkfield lobby were replaced last month with keypad-and-badge units. Your permanent badge arrives from Security within three working days; until then you will use a temporary entry code at the left-hand turnstile only. Collect a lanyard from reception first. Enter the following code when prompted:

badge for hahip-bagag: bdg-FIJ-9

## BranchSweeper: Limits and Quotas

BranchSweeper scans every repository in the Oakmere org nightly and flags branches with no commits past the staleness threshold. Deletion only occurs after a warning period and never touches protected branches. Maintainers should note that raising the scan batch size increases API quota consumption roughly linearly. The operative constants, enforced in config and mirrored in tests, are these.

tuning table, yajog-yahof:
BUDGETS = {
    "lamvan": 303,
    "wenox": 460,
    "fenvan": 525,
}